Firmware hex file format

For example, printers with updated firmware experience increased print resolution, faster execution times, and boot times. Televisions with updated firmware experience better resolution and fewer glitches. The firmware parts of a personal computer (PC) are just as important as the operating system (OS). But, unlike an OS, firmware can’t automatically fix problems that are found after the unit has been shipped. A personal computer’s basic input/output system (BIOS) is an example of a firmware component. The BIOS lets the PC’s operating system (OS) talk to keyboards and other connected devices. If you roll back a firmware update correctly, your device’s firmware should go back to an older version.

  • Sometimes manufacturers release firmware updates, which help to make the system more powerful and capable of working speedily.
  • Yes, you can flash firmware without a bootloader by using an external programmer that writes the firmware to the ICSP of your motherboard.
  • Additionally, it offers benefits in order to change it for a newer device as it can be altered without the need to exchange the hardware.
  • The Address pane is displayed in the beginning of the first byte of a line.

You may be required to also install JAVA in order to setup this program. Unpack the archive and put the sketch folder somewhere convenient. We have created a standalone error hex that can be combined with a V2 only hex to produce a Hex that will work on a V2 board, but error if used on a V1. A clear indication that you are working with this format is that a compiled .hex file will be ~1.8Mb as opposed to ~700Kb in size. If you are certain that you only want to use ArduPilot on the board, then flashing the ardupilot bootloader enables much simpler subsequent upgrades. There are various ways to program the nRF Sniffer firmware. The

We also recommend you download the Unified 2 STL pack as well download the stock firmware. This contains EZABL mounts, Gantry leveling Blocks, Solid bed mounts, and Bed Level test files. Realize 300-degree high-temperature printing and support automatic leveling. It is not uncommon that a 3d printer suddenly has a shift in the X or Y axis at a random layer and all of the remaining ones. Although lots of enthusiasts may think that this may be caused by a firmware problem leading to the printer randomly forgetting its home position, the real cause of the problem is in the hardware. After you successfully complete this process, you will definitely feel like a pro, and will most surely run circles around your community of 3D printers.

  • create shortcuts in the same program GROUP.
  • A straightforward and rather common task would be to replace a set of bytes.
  • In these cases, locate the firmware.bin file and copy it to the SD card manually.
  • The Ender 5 Pro BLtouch kit includes everything you need for the upgrade.
  • It works closely with the firmware to ensure the hardware functions and is the primary interface between the user and applications.

following instructions use nRF Connect Programmer, but you can also use the command-line tool nrfjprog (which is part of the nRF Command Line Tools). The filename of the firmware for the MMU2S is ‘prusa3d_fw_MMU2board_x_x_x_’, where the x is the firmware version number. Do not select the MK3S firmware located in the same folder.